| Term | Definition |
|---|---|
Define a ‘technical control’ | Hardware or software mechanisms used to protect assets. Additionally, antivirus software, firewalls, and intrusion detection systems are examples of technical controls. |
Define an ‘operational control’ | Controls that involve actions, such as adhering to security policies and procedures to enhance user behavior while mitigating security risks. |
What mechanism can be implemented to grant permissions based on the users role? | Policy enforcement points |
Define a ‘Policy enforcement point’ | Enforces decisions about whether to grant access to a requested resource or not. |
What type of sensors do motion detectors use? | Infrared sensors. |
Define ‘tokenization’ | Replacing all or part of a value with a randomly generated token. |
